Gastric Acid Secretion
Gastric Acid Secretion
The process of producing hydrochloric acid in the stomach, regulated by the vagus nerve, gastrin, and histamine.
Nutrient Absorption
Nutrient Absorption
The process of taking nutrients from food into the bloodstream, primarily in the duodenum, jejunum, and ileum.
Na+ and Fluid Transport
Na+ and Fluid Transport
Sodium (Na+) plays a crucial role in fluid absorption throughout the small and large intestines, regulating water movement.
